If you are connecting to physical devices (such as Blade PCs) with PCoIP host cards, use a Web
browser to configure the host card as appropriate for your environment. For more information about
Host Card configuration, see the appropriate zero client Quick Start Guide (included) and PC-over-IP
System User's Guide (download from ClearCube Support).

The table below shows how to connect to physical devices (such as Blade PCs).
Step
1
From the keyboard, press CTRL, CTRL, F11, b to set the mouse to relative mode.
You can now use the mouse to configure the zero client or connect to a remote host.
